What Makes Class 4 Shingles Different From Standard Asphalt Shingles
Class 4 shingles pass UL 2218 impact testing by surviving multiple 2-inch steel ball drops from 20 feet without tearing or cracking. Standard architectural shingles typically fail at Class 3 or below. The difference comes from a reinforced mat layer and higher-density asphalt that absorbs hail strikes without fracturing the granule surface or puncturing the mat.
Virginia's hail belt—stretching from Shenandoah Valley through central counties including Albemarle, Augusta, and Rockingham—sees hail events 2–4 times per season during spring and early summer months. Most hailstones measure under 1 inch, but storms producing 1.5–2.5 inch hail occur annually in this region. Class 4 shingles rated for 2-inch impacts handle these events without the granule loss and mat bruising that shorten standard shingle lifespan.
Major manufacturers offering Class 4 options include GAF Timberline HDZ RS, CertainTeed Integrity Roof System, Owens Corning Duration Storm, IKO Dynasty, and Malarkey Legacy. Each uses proprietary impact-resistant technology but all meet the same UL 2218 Class 4 standard. Warranty terms vary by product line, with most offering 50-year limited material coverage and 15-year algae resistance.
How Much Class 4 Shingles Cost in Virginia Compared to Standard Options
Class 4 impact-resistant shingles cost $150–$250 per square installed in Virginia markets, compared to $120–$180 per square for standard architectural shingles. On a 2,000 square foot roof requiring 22–24 squares of material, that adds $3,000–$6,000 to total project cost. Estimates based on available industry data; individual project costs vary by roof size, pitch, material, and regional labor rates.
The premium pays for reinforced mat construction and higher-impact asphalt compounds. Installation labor rates stay roughly the same since Class 4 shingles install using standard methods—no specialized tools or techniques required. Tear-off, underlayment, flashing, and ventilation work costs the same regardless of shingle impact rating.
Insurance discounts offset some of the upfront cost. Virginia insurers offer premium reductions of 5–30% for Class 4 roofs in hail-prone counties, with exact discounts varying by carrier and loss history in your ZIP code. A homeowner paying $1,800 annually for coverage might save $90–$540 per year with a Class 4 roof, recovering the material premium in 5–15 years depending on discount rate and roof size.
Which Virginia Counties Qualify for Insurance Discounts on Class 4 Roofs
Most Virginia insurers offer Class 4 discounts in counties with documented hail frequency above regional averages. Albemarle, Augusta, Rockingham, Page, Shenandoah, Warren, Clarke, Frederick, Loudoun, and Fauquier counties typically qualify based on National Weather Service hail event data from the past decade. Coastal counties including Virginia Beach, Norfolk, and Hampton sometimes qualify for wind-impact discounts rather than hail-specific credits.
Discount rates depend on your carrier's actuarial model and your property's claims history. State Farm, Allstate, USAA, and Nationwide all publish Class 4 discount programs, but the percentage varies. Request a written quote adjustment from your agent showing the exact premium reduction before committing to Class 4 material—some discounts apply only to wind/hail coverage portions, not the entire premium.
Documentation requirements vary by carrier. Most require proof of installation through contractor invoice showing manufacturer name and Class 4 product line, plus photos of bundle labels on-site during installation. Some carriers send their own inspector to verify material before applying the discount. Confirm documentation steps with your agent before the roofing project starts to avoid delays in discount approval.
How Long Class 4 Shingles Last on Virginia Roofs After Hail Exposure
Class 4 shingles installed in Virginia hail belts typically last 25–35 years with normal maintenance, compared to 18–25 years for standard architectural shingles in the same climate. The difference comes from reduced granule loss and mat degradation after repeated hail strikes. A roof that survives 8–12 hail events over two decades without needing repair holds its waterproofing integrity longer than one replaced twice in the same period.
Lifespan depends on installation quality and attic ventilation as much as impact rating. A Class 4 roof installed over insufficient ridge venting or without proper ice-and-water barrier in valleys will fail early regardless of hail resistance. Virginia's heat and humidity cycle accelerates asphalt aging, so proper ventilation that keeps deck temperatures below 160°F extends shingle life by 5–10 years.
Manufacturer warranties cover material defects but not storm damage. A 50-year warranty on Class 4 shingles guarantees the product won't delaminate or lose excessive granules under normal conditions—it does not guarantee the roof survives every hailstorm without damage. Insurance covers storm repairs; the warranty covers manufacturing failures.
What Contractors Installing Class 4 Roofs in Virginia Should Provide
Licensed roofing contractors in Virginia should provide written estimates breaking out material cost, labor, underlayment type, ventilation upgrades, and permit fees before starting work. For Class 4 projects, confirm the estimate specifies manufacturer name and product line—generic "impact-resistant shingles" language leaves room for substitution with Class 3 products that don't qualify for insurance discounts.
Contractors handling storm damage replacements should document pre-installation roof condition with photos showing hail bruising, granule loss, or mat fractures. This documentation supports insurance claims and creates a baseline for future inspections. Ask for deck inspection results in writing—hail impacts sometimes crack decking or damage truss connections that need repair before new shingles go on.
Permit requirements vary by municipality in Virginia. Most counties require permits for full roof replacements but not for repairs under a certain square footage threshold set locally. Your contractor should pull permits, schedule inspections, and provide final approval documentation. Verify their Virginia contractor license status and general liability coverage before signing—municipal licensing requirements apply in most Virginia cities, and many counties require registration with the local building department.
